Title: Intermediate Inputs Share for Manufacturing: Basic Chemical Manufacturing (NAICS 3251) in the United States Series ID: IPUEN3251P030000000 Source: U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ics Release: Industry Productivity Seasonal Adjustment: Not Seasonally Adjusted Frequency: Annual Units: Percent Date Range: 1987-01-01 to 2021-01-01 Last Updated: 2023-09-01 1:31 PM CDT Notes: Intermediate inputs share is the proportion of the total dollar value to produce output of goods and services attributed to use of intermediate inputs (energy, materials, and services). DATE VALUE 1987-01-01 0.609 1988-01-01 0.590 1989-01-01 0.590 1990-01-01 0.600 1991-01-01 0.628 1992-01-01 0.639 1993-01-01 0.637 1994-01-01 0.629 1995-01-01 0.603 1996-01-01 0.655 1997-01-01 0.624 1998-01-01 0.582 1999-01-01 0.637 2000-01-01 0.696 2001-01-01 0.723 2002-01-01 0.659 2003-01-01 0.668 2004-01-01 0.625 2005-01-01 0.619 2006-01-01 0.615 2007-01-01 0.650 2008-01-01 0.678 2009-01-01 0.640 2010-01-01 0.624 2011-01-01 0.654 2012-01-01 0.663 2013-01-01 0.669 2014-01-01 0.661 2015-01-01 0.618 2016-01-01 0.586 2017-01-01 0.620 2018-01-01 0.618 2019-01-01 0.607 2020-01-01 0.598 2021-01-01 0.556
